이 구절의 의미
This verse asks God to make all the nations of the world happy and sing because He will rule over them fairly and justly. The psalmist is speaking, expressing a desire for God's justice to spread across the earth.

역사적 배경
Psalms 67 was written by the sons of Korah, a group of temple singers. It was likely written during the time of King David or Solomon. The verse reflects a desire for God's justice and righteousness to be known among all nations.
